LSA | Brent
A friendly primary school in Brent is seeking a dependable LSA to join their support staff from January 2026. The successful LSA will assist with classroom differentiation, deliver intervention programmes, support pupils with additional needs and promote positive behaviour. This LSA position in Brent will commence January 2026, with induction and handover scheduled before January 2026.
• LSA required for a key support role in KS1/KS2
• LSA required to work within a busy primary in Brent
• LSA to provide targeted academic and pastoral support across classes
The LSA will be expected to run phonics groups, support guided reading, scaffold maths activities and contribute to pupils’ social and emotional development. Working in Brent, the LSA will be part of a committed team that values consistent adult support to help pupils make progress.
Responsibilities
- Lead small-group interventions, monitor progress and adapt approaches to maximise impact.
- Support teachers by preparing resources, scaffolding tasks and encouraging pupil independence.
- Assist with behaviour management and pastoral care to support pupil wellbeing throughout the school day.
- Maintain records of interventions and contribute to team discussions about next steps for pupils in Brent.
- Help supervise activities and support transitions to ensure a calm learning environment.
Person specification
- Experience supporting children in schools, with confidence delivering interventions and classroom support as an LSA.
- Patient, organised and able to work proactively with teachers and SENCo in Brent.
- Able to start January 2026 and to attend pre-start induction and training before January 2026.
